    I think to run a strip of about 20 ft you need between 20 to 25 W. So at 12V, we are talking about 2 amps. My initial estimate on battery size was a little low, so going with a 3+ amp-hr 12V battery maybe best. That still is a small (5"x2.5"x2.5") cheap (< $15) lead acid battery which will give you 1-2 hrs of continuous lighting if running at their brightest. A dimming switch to reduce current use maybe helpful. It would probably go a year (based on how much I would use the bed lights) before I would have to use one of those cheap harbor freight rechargers to recharge it.
